Read moreFISH ALLERGY ALERT!!! Although the menu lists "Crab or Crabmeat" on certain items, IT IS KRAB meat, which is an imitation crab meat that is made with various types of FISH.....and to a person with fish allergies, that misrepresentation could have deadly consequences.
